Introduction "MySQL master-slave replication" technology is widely used in common high-availability architectures in the Internet industry, such as the common one-master-slave replication architecture, keepalived + MySQL dual-master (master-slave) replication architecture, MHA + one master and two slaves The replication architecture and so on all apply MySQL master-slave replication technology. However, since master-slave replication is a logical replication based on binlog, the risk of inconsistency in replicated data is inevitable. This risk will not only cause inconsistency in user data access, but also lead to 1032 and 1062 errors in subsequent replication, which will cause the hidden danger of stagnation in the replication architecture. , In order to discover and solve this problem in time, we need to regularly or irregularly carry out master-slave replication data consistency verification and repair work, so how to achieve this work? How to automate this work? Let's explore these questions. 2. Introduction: master-slave Consistency verification scenario: Some people may ask: How to verify the consistency of master-slave? Or ask: Are the master-slave structure data of dozens of tables in a library consistent? To put it simply, you can use select count(*) on the master and slave respectively during the off-peak period to take a look. This method is the oldest and the accuracy is not very high.
